Does anyone dump their copy of the routing table to a flat file regularly and make this available? I need do some queries. The web based versions don't accept modifiers like "lon" on the show ip bgp commands.
I have a perl script which converts the output of 'sh ip bgp' into SQL (MySQL). I keep 'prefix', 'neighbor AS' and 'AS path' informations... the rest is droped... I use this for extended queries into my RouteViewer... Tell me if you're interested... regards, Pascal
